Amazon.com Review The casual Cappuccino dinnerware from Pfaltzgraff takes its cue from the rich shades of gourmet coffee. This gravy boat and saucer matches an abundance of subtly flecked tan glaze to a creamy white background. Crafted from durable stoneware, the boat features generous curves and a wide pour spout, while concentric ridges on the saucer add depth to the color palette. A raised center ridge on the saucer keeps the boat in place, and the handle, though a bit narrow, is large enough for easy gripping. Both boat and saucer are substantial in construction and safe in the freezer, microwave, oven, and dishwasher. The boat holds 16 ounces, and the saucer measures 8-1/4 inches in diameter. Pfaltzgraff includes a three-year warranty. --Emily Bedard
